    Some of the College Football awards were presented yesterday:

    http://nbcsports.msnbc.com/id/28182973/

    All-American team:
    Joining Colt McCoy on the Walter Camp All-American team were running backs Greene (Iowa) and Javon Ringer (Michigan State); wide receivers Crabtree (Texas Tech) and Dez Bryant (Oklahoma State); tight end Chase Coffman (Missouri); and offensive linemen Michael Oher (Mississippi), Andre Smith (Alabama), Duke Robinson (Oklahoma), Rylan Reed (Texas Tech) and A.Q. Shipley (Penn State).

    MAXWELL AWARD (Best player)
    Tim Tebow, Florida

    WALTER CAMP (Best player)
    Colt McCoy, Texas

    O'BRIEN AWARD (Top QB)
    Sam Bradford, Oklahoma

    WALKER AWARD (Top RB)
    Shonn Greene, Iowa

    BILETNIKOFF AWARD (Top WR)
    Michael Crabtree, Texas Tech

    MACKEY AWARD (Top TE)
    Chase Coffman, Missouri

    OUTLAND TROPHY (Top interior lineman)
    Andre Smith, Alabama

    RIMINGTON AWARD (Top center)
    A.Q. Shipley, Penn State

    BEDNARIK TROPHY (Top def. player)
    Rey Maualuga, USC

    BUTKUS AWARD (Top linebacker)
    Aaron Curry, Wake Forest

    THORPE AWARD (Best defensive back)
    Malcolm Jenkins, Ohio State

    LOMBARDI AWARD (Top lineman)
    Brian Orakpo, Texas

    GROZA AWARD (Top kicker)
    Graham Gano, Florida State

    GUY AWARD (Top punter)
    Matt Fodge, Oklahoma State

    Draddy Trophy (Top scholar athlete)
    Alex Mack, California

    HOME DEPOT COACH OF YEAR
    Nick Saban, Alabama

    BROYLES AWARD (Top assistant coach)
    Kevin Wilson, Oklahoma
